Kan. Admin. Regs. § 99-27-2 - Civil penalty; order
Each order that assesses a civil penalty shall include the following elements:
(a) A statement
reciting each subsection of the act authorizing the assessment of a civil
penalty;
(b) a specific reference
to each provision of the act or implementing regulation that the respondent is
alleged to have violated;
(c) a
concise statement of the factual basis for each alleged violation;
(d) the amount of the civil penalty; and
(e) a notice of the respondent's
right to request a hearing.
